当前位置:首页 > 行业动态 > 正文

如何利用字体CDN来优化网页加载速度?

字体CDN是一种将字体文件存储在分布式服务器上的技术,以便更快地加载到用户的设备上。

字体CDN一种通过内容分发网络(CDN)技术来提高网页字体加载效率的方法,以下是关于字体CDN的详细解析:

1、定义:字体CDN是一种利用CDN技术,将字体文件存储在多个地理位置分布的服务器上,以便用户能够更快地从最近的服务器获取字体文件,从而提高网页加载速度和用户体验。

2、优势:使用字体CDN可以显著提高字体文件的加载速度,减少等待时间,提升用户体验,通过CDN的分布式架构,可以减轻源服务器的负载,提高网站的稳定性和可用性,大多数CDN服务都提供了安全防护措施,如DDoS攻击防护、SSL加密等,增强了网站的安全性。

3、实现方式:开发者可以通过修改HTML或CSS代码,直接链接到CDN提供的字体文件URL,从而引入所需的字体,这种方式简单快捷,无需额外配置。

4、应用场景:适用于需要快速加载大量字体文件的大型网站或应用,如新闻网站、电商平台等,对于面向全球用户的网站,使用字体CDN可以确保不同地区的用户都能快速加载字体,提供一致的用户体验。

5、注意事项:虽然CDN可以提高加载速度,但并非所有CDN服务都支持所有字体格式,因此需要选择合适的CDN提供商,在使用第三方CDN服务时,需要注意版权问题,确保所使用的字体文件具有合法的使用权。

字体CDN是一种有效的网页性能优化技术,它通过分布式存储和快速响应机制,提高了字体文件的加载速度和网站的用户体验,在选择和使用字体CDN时,开发者应综合考虑CDN的性能、安全性、成本以及版权等因素,以确保网站的高效稳定运行。

字体CDN 描述 优势 缺点
Google Fonts 提供大量免费字体资源,易于使用 无需本地存储字体文件,减少服务器负载,支持响应式设计 部分字体版权问题,加载速度可能受网络环境影响
Typekit Adobe 提供的字体服务,提供大量专业字体 字体质量高,支持字重、字宽等自定义,易于管理 价格较高,部分字体需要付费使用
Font Squirrel 提供免费字体下载,可免费商用 字体种类丰富,支持免费商用 部分字体可能存在版权问题,需要用户自行判断
Fonts.com 提供大量专业字体资源,支持订阅模式 字体质量高,支持多种字重和字宽,支持在线预览 价格较高,需要订阅服务
CSS.Fonts 提供免费字体资源,支持在线预览 字体种类丰富,支持在线预览,易于选择 部分字体可能存在版权问题,需要用户自行判断
MyFonts 提供大量专业字体资源,支持购买 字体质量高,支持多种字重和字宽,支持在线预览 价格较高,需要购买字体授权
Cloudflare Workers 将字体资源托管在 Cloudflare 上,支持自定义缓存策略 支持自定义缓存策略,提高加载速度,降低服务器负载 需要一定的技术能力,设置较为复杂
0